SCFG Artwork Flyer Collection Announcement:



 If you see these flyers hanging up around town, here is a little bit more information on why, who, what, where, and when!

Why, Why, Why

We want to create a budget with fundraising efforts from a collective effort to raise money for support in local efforts of financial relief. The holidays arriving could benefit from a small effort of prepared volunteers, events for fundraising towards a better cause, and fundraised "giveaways" to help support local business and talent in our community while having fun! We will be creating new ways to fundraise throughout the year and updating an online community with this blog: www.seymourcommunitygroup.blogspot.com!

What - types of things will you be doing?

Creating events and efforts to raise money for community sponsored fundraising efforts. After creating our bylaws and selecting our officers to become an official group - this announcement is going to be posted, while the other tab on the home page of the blog called "Group Agenda" is where you will find more information on this if you are interested. We want to sort through and select our efforts to encourage and help will be based on overall budget, impact, and targeted audience with requested volunteer group size. We want to create a place where we can gather as a resource to help our community raise funds for personal reasons and things that we want to see in return from them to create a community effort. 
The example of this is to volunteer for the next effort, to attend a sponsored event, to provide a donation when you can, to participate in a local event. We may request a type of term of commitment we want to see you invest back into your community while we pull together and help your cause, effort, reason of request. 
There will be ongoing projects that may need support. Those will be posted here on the blog and expansion into other social media will be expected to get communication opened with our causes. 
We want to have fun, raising money and healthy participation, for our community! 

Who - is going to be involved?

Seymour Community residents are welcome to join. If you have a personal criminal history, if you could please inform us of any restraints that you may have with children or elderly, that would be appreciated. You will be subject to an open record search. 

When can I suggest a fundraising effort?

We will prepare a form and place it in a tab on the blog website when that is available. 
We want to encourage participation and will base these sponsorships by season. If there are ongoing efforts that can be done, small groups will form and continue those efforts. The idea is to create a reliable budget to assist with learning small job skills to document and help others in a time of need (from home business ideas with the fundraising efforts expanding to an eBay account or Etsy account, etc.) to hold as a resource. Project management skills, budgeting, and other resources can be made available to raise efforts for the local pantry and education system.

Where is this being held?

Seymour Community Fundraising Groups (SCFG) will be hosting their meetings virtually until a larger group can participate. Then we will post a venue to host a meeting to get participation, events, and other community announcements together for an in-house pot luck. Can't have a meeting without food! The larger the group the more that can be done!

Summary

This is just a friendly reminder if we want to see change and prevention in our community - we have to support each other and become available to help so that in our time of need, we will be best assisted by those that truly do care about us. We are productive with our time and encourage growth within the group. I expect to see training groups, events of creativity, and local reasons to get out there and shop around!
